Output 73d5c5e55f8aef124257de1ca8232c0fd2dbe094098e29c2603f175a12206a7a:0

value
368305422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b026f9a862ca82c2f93b20acbaa5a6253171ab OP_EQUAL
address
3CEiespHKgBdzXzzwHex4AHvFMHMEknPkW
transaction
73d5c5e55f8aef124257de1ca8232c0fd2dbe094098e29c2603f175a12206a7a
spent
true